Задать вопрос
@DemetrioMoscow

Vue 3 события. Как задать v-on для программно создаваемого компонента?

Создаю компонент программно, примерно так:

let component = defineComponent({
    extends: ExampleComponent
});

const div = document.createElement('div');
let app = createApp(component, props).mount(div);

Хочу из создаваемого компонента через emit передать событие родителю. Как его прослушать?

Во Vue2 можно было сделать так - app.$on('someevent', handler), какие есть варианты во Vue 3?
  • Вопрос задан
  • 59 просмотров
Подписаться 1 Простой 1 комментарий
Ответ пользователя aloky К ответам на вопрос (2)
aloky
@aloky
js
Я бы использовал dispatchEvent
Ответ написан
Комментировать